This script now works for the new modern youtube layout!

When you are watching a video, you can add any suggestion to the queue by hovering over said video and clicking the "Add to queue" button (Classic) or clicking the thumbnail "Queue" overlay button (Modern).

Features

  • Create a queue with videos that you want to play next (instead of the autoplay suggestion)
  • Add suggested videos to the queue
  • Search videos without interrupting the player (Script with only this feature)
  • Add searched videos to the queue
  • Remove videos from the queue
  • Decide which video in the queue you want to play next
  • Remove queue
  • Autoplay will be used when the queue is empty (When turned on)
  • Restore suggestion when queue is empty

Modern Youtube Only:

  • Enable the miniplayer and you'll be able to add any video to the queue
